JPH04189167A - オーバレイ展開制御方式 - Google Patents

オーバレイ展開制御方式

Info

Publication number
JPH04189167A
JPH04189167A JP2320320A JP32032090A JPH04189167A JP H04189167 A JPH04189167 A JP H04189167A JP 2320320 A JP2320320 A JP 2320320A JP 32032090 A JP32032090 A JP 32032090A JP H04189167 A JPH04189167 A JP H04189167A
Authority
JP
Japan
Prior art keywords
overlay
data
printing
overlay data
section
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
JP2320320A
Other languages
English (en)
Inventor
Seiichi Kurihara
清一 栗原
Naoto Fujii
直人 藤井
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Fujitsu Ltd
Original Assignee
Fujitsu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Fujitsu Ltd filed Critical Fujitsu Ltd
Priority to JP2320320A priority Critical patent/JPH04189167A/ja
Publication of JPH04189167A publication Critical patent/JPH04189167A/ja
Pending legal-status Critical Current

Links

Landscapes

  • Record Information Processing For Printing (AREA)

Abstract

(57)【要約】本公報は電子出願前の出願データであるた
め要約のデータは記録されません。

Description

【発明の詳細な説明】 [概要] カット紙プリンタ装置におけるオーバレイ展開制御方式
に関し、 両面印刷時に表面と裏面に同一オーバレイデータの印刷
がある場合、表面に展開したオーバレイを配置データで
制御して、裏面にも印刷するこきができるようして、印
刷速度を向上させるようにしたオーバレイ展開制御方式
を提供することを目的とし、 オーバレイデータを展開するオーバレイ展開処理部と、
展開されたオーバレイデータを保存しておくビットマツ
プメモリと、保存されているオーバレイデータの印刷制
御を行う印刷制御部を備え、同一のオーバレイデータを
表面および裏面に印刷するときは、1回だけオーバレイ
展開処理を行い、その同一オーバレイデータを配置デー
タにより制御する制御手段を設けて、両面のオーバレイ
データの印刷制御を行うように構成する。
「産業上の利用分野] 本発明は、カット紙プリンタ装置におけるオーバレイ展
開制御方式に関する。
コンピュータシステムの高速化に伴い、その出力デバイ
スの一つであるプリンタ装置においても、高速化が要求
されている。
このため、印刷速度の低下につながる要因の一つである
両面印刷時のオーバレイ展開をより高速化する必要があ
る。
[従来の技術] 従来のカット紙プリンタ装置における両面印刷時のオー
バレイ展開制御方式においては、第9図のフローチャー
トに示すように、表面と裏面がともに同一オーバレイデ
ータの印刷であっても、とじしろを考慮にいれると、表
面は、第10図(3)に示すように、ビットマツプメモ
リ (BMM)1上でオーバレイデータ2が展開され、
裏面は、第10図(4)に示すように、ビットマツプメ
モリ1上でオーバレイデータ2が展開される。
そして、展開結果を保存しているビットマツプメモリ1
が用紙と1対1で対応しているため、表面のために展開
したオーバレイデータ2を裏面に使用することができな
い。すなわち、第10図(1)に示す表面の印刷結果お
よび第10図(2)に示す裏面の印刷結果を得るために
は、表面と裏面で同一オーバレイデータ2であってもペ
ージ毎にオーバレイ展開処理を行っていた。
[発明が解決しようとする課題] しかしながら、このような従来のオーバレイ展開制御方
式にあっては、両面印刷時において、表面と裏面に同一
オーバレイデータを印刷しようとする場合でもページ毎
にオーバレイ展開処理を行うようにしているため、無駄
な展開時間が消費され、印刷速度の低下を招くという問
題点があった。
本発明は、このような従来の問題点に鑑みてなされたも
のであって、両面印刷時に表面と裏面に同一オーバレイ
の印刷がある場合、表面に展開したオーバレイを配置デ
ータで制御して、裏面にも印刷することができるように
して、印刷速度を向上させるようにしたオーバレイ展開
制御方式を提供することを目的としている。
[課題を解決するための手段] 第1図は本発明の原理説明図である。
第1図において、26はオーバレイデータ42を展開す
るオーバレイ展開処理部、27は展開されたオーバレイ
データ42を保存しておくビットマツプメモリ、28は
保存されているオーバレイデータ42の印刷制御を行う
印刷制御部、29は同一のオーバレイデータ42を表面
および裏面に印刷するときは、1回だけオーバレイ展開
処理を行い、その同一オーバレイデータ42を配置デー
タにより制御する制御手段である。
[作用] 本発明においては、両面のオーバレイ印刷の表面の処理
時には、オーバレイ展開処理部26でオーバレイデータ
42の展開処理を一回行い、ビットマツプメモリ27に
保存し、印刷制御部28で表面の印刷制御を行う。つぎ
に、裏面の処理時には、表面と同一オーバレイデータ4
2であれば、オーバレイ展開処理部26で展開しないで
印刷制御部28に配置データ(オフセット値)の指示と
ともに印刷制御依頼をすることにより裏面の印刷を行う
。したがって、裏面が表面と同一オーバレイデータ42
の場合、展開処理を省くことができ、オーバレイデータ
42を伴う両面印刷時の印刷速度の向上を図ることがで
きる。
[実施例] 以下、本発明の実施例を図面に基づいて説明する。
第2図〜第8図は本発明の一実施例を示す図である。
第2図はプリントコントローラ装置を示す図である。
第2図において、11はホストCPU12から文字デー
タまたはオーバレイデータが入力するチャネルコントロ
ーラ、13はダイレクトメモリアクセスを制御するDM
Aコントローラ、14はシステムプログラムが格納され
るROM、15はフロッピィドライブを制御するFDコ
ントローラ、16はエラーなどの表示などを行うオペレ
ーションパネルである。
17はチャネルコントローラ11を介して文字データが
入力するメモリ、18および19は文字データの展開を
それぞれ行う文字データ展開部、20はフラグなどが格
納されるメモリ、21は文字データの展開を制御するM
PU、22は展開された文字データが保存されるビット
マツプメモリ、23は展開された文字データの印刷の制
御を行う印刷制御部、24は展開された文字データまた
は展開されたオーバレイデータの印刷を行うメカ部であ
る。
25はチャネルコントローラ11を介してオーバレイデ
ータが格納されるフォームズオーバレイメモリ、26は
フォームズオーバレイメモリ25にセットされたホスト
CPU12からの圧縮されたオーバレイデータを所定の
アルゴリズムにより生データに伸長し、ビデオ展開する
オーバレイ展開処理部、27は展開されたオーバレイデ
ータを保存しておくビットマツプメモリ、28は展開さ
れたオーバレイデータの印刷の制御を行うもので、ビッ
トマツプメモリ27の対応するアドレスデータを読み取
り、メカ部24にビデオ信号を出力する印刷制御部であ
る。
29はこのプリントコントローラ装置の全体を制御する
MPUであり、MPU29は、同一のオーバレイデータ
を表面および裏面に印刷するとき、1回だけオーバレイ
展開処理を行い、配置データで制御して、表面で一度展
開したデータを裏面に使用することができるように制御
する制御手段としての機能を有する。
次に、前記印刷制御部28は、第3図に示すような印刷
制御レジスタ30を有している。
印刷制御レジスタ30は、ステータス部(STR)31
、コマンド部(CMR)32、プリンタコントロール部
(PCR)33、プリンタステータス部(PSR)34
、マスクビット部(MBR)35、インタラブドフラグ
部(IFR)36、イクスクルーシブオアピット部(E
BR)37、テスト部(TSTR)38、レフトマージ
ン部(LMR)39、ワイドデータ部(WDR)40お
よびメモリアドレス部(MAR)41より構成されてい
る。
また、メモリアドレス部(MAR)41には、第4図に
示すように、ラストライン、オン/オフ、アップ/ダウ
ン、レフト/ライト、クリアの各制御情報およびビット
マツプメモリ27上の先頭アドレスが設定される。
次に、動作を説明する。
第5図は動作を説明するフローチャートである。
第5図において、まず、表面の場合、ステップS1で同
一オーバレイであるか否かを判別し、同一オーバレイで
ないときは、ステップS2でオーバレイ展開処理を行い
、ステップS3で印刷処理を行う。
次に、裏面の場合、ステップS1で同一オーバレイであ
るかを判別し、同一オーバレイであるときは、ステップ
S4で両面印刷であるか否かを判別し、両面印刷である
ときは、ステップS5で配置データ(オフセット)の指
定を行う。
すなわち、同一オーバレイの展開は一回のみとし、両面
の場合、その配置データの変更により一度展開したデー
タをそのまま利用するようにしている。
ここで、表面および裏面の展開データを共有するために
は、ビットマツプメモリ27に展開したオーバレイデー
タを用紙送り方向に対してX方向およびY方向に移動さ
せることが必要となる。
第6図において、レフトマージン部(LMR)39はス
キャン方向の各スキャン開始信号よりドラムの書き込み
開始までのドツトを示すレジスタであり、この値が0に
なったワイドデータ部(WDR)40の値によりドラム
書き込み信号をオンにする。なお、第6図中、■はメモ
リアドレス部(MAR)41内のビデオオフ区間を、■
はビデオオン区間を、示す。
このレフトマージン部(LMR)39の値は、ドツト単
位に制御が可能であり、この値の変更が紙送り方向に対
するX方向の配置移動に対して有効である。すなわち、
第7図に示すように紙送り方向に対するX方向へのオー
バレイデータ42の配置移動は、MPU29より印刷制
御部28に依頼する時点で、レフトマージン部(LMR
)39に表面の場合にはNを、裏面の場合にはMを設定
することにより、行うことができる。
また、前述したように、メモリアドレス部(MAR)4
1には、第4図に示すように、ビットマツプメモリ27
上の先頭アドレスと各制御情報が設定されており、この
先頭アドルスの設定値の変更が紙送り方向に対するX方
向の配置移動に対して有効である。
すなわち、紙送り方向に対するX方向へのオーバレイデ
ータ42の配置移動は、第8図に示すように、MPU2
9より印刷制御部28に依頼する時点で、メモリアドレ
ス部(MAR)41に設定するビットマツプメモリ27
の先頭アドルスを表面の場合にはAの値を、裏面の場合
にはBの値を設定することにより、行うことかできる。
[発明の効果] 以上説明したように、本発明によれば、カット紙プリン
タ装置の両面印刷時において、同一オーバレイ印刷があ
る場合、オーバレイ展開を表面および裏面に対して行う
必要かなく、表面で一度印刷したオーバレイ展開データ
を裏面にも利用することができ、オーバレイ展開の処理
時間を省くことができ、印刷速度を向上させることがで
きる。
【図面の簡単な説明】
第1図は本発明の原理説明図、 第2図は本発明の一実施例を示す図、 第3図はプリンタ制御レジスタの構成図、第4図はメモ
リアドレス部の構成図、 第5図は動作を説明するフローチャート、第6図はLM
RさWDRの説明図、 第7図はX方向配置移動の説明図、 第8図はX方向配置移動の説明図、 第9図は従来のフローチャート、 第10図は印刷結果とビットマツプメモリを示す図であ
る。 図中、 11・・・チャネルコントローラ、 12・・・ホストCPU。 13・・・DMAコントローラ、 14・・・ROM。 15・・・FDコントローラ、 16・・・オペレーションパネル、 17・・・メモリ、 18.19・・・文字データ展開部、 20・・・メモリ、 21・・・MPU。 22・・・ビットマツプメモリ、 23・・・印刷制御部、 24・・・メカ部、 25・・・フォームズオーバレイメモリ、26・・・オ
ーバレイ展開処理部、 27・・・ビットマツプメモリ、 28・・・印刷制御部、 29・・・MPU (制御手段)、 30・・・印刷制御レジスタ、 31・・・ステータス部、 32・・・コマンド部、 33・・・プリンタコントロール部、 34・・・プリンタステータス部、 35・・・マスクビット部、 26・・・インタラブドフラグ部、 37・・・イクスクルーシブオアビット部、38・・・
テスト部、 39・・・レフトマージン部、 40・・・ワイドデータ部、 41・・・メモリアドレス部、 42・・・オーバレイデータ。

Claims (1)

  1. 【特許請求の範囲】 オーバレイデータ(42)を展開するオーバレイ展開処
    理部(26)と、展開されたオーバレイデータ(42)
    を保存しておくビットマップメモリ(27)と、保存さ
    れているオーバレイデータ(42)の印刷制御を行う印
    刷制御部(28)を備え、 同一のオーバレイデータ(42)を表面および裏面に印
    刷するときは、1回だけオーバレイ展開処理を行い、そ
    の同一オーバレイデータ(42)を配置データにより制
    御する制御手段(29)を設けて、両面のオーバレイデ
    ータ(42)の印刷制御を行うことを特徴とするオーバ
    レイ展開制御方式。
JP2320320A 1990-11-22 1990-11-22 オーバレイ展開制御方式 Pending JPH04189167A (ja)

Priority Applications (1)

Application Number Priority Date Filing Date Title
JP2320320A JPH04189167A (ja) 1990-11-22 1990-11-22 オーバレイ展開制御方式

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
JP2320320A JPH04189167A (ja) 1990-11-22 1990-11-22 オーバレイ展開制御方式

Publications (1)

Publication Number Publication Date
JPH04189167A true JPH04189167A (ja) 1992-07-07

Family

ID=18120173

Family Applications (1)

Application Number Title Priority Date Filing Date
JP2320320A Pending JPH04189167A (ja) 1990-11-22 1990-11-22 オーバレイ展開制御方式

Country Status (1)

Country Link
JP (1) JPH04189167A (ja)

Cited By (2)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5456539A (en) * 1993-05-25 1995-10-10 Duplex Printer, Inc. Printer with dual opposing printheads
JP2005047267A (ja) * 2003-07-14 2005-02-24 Riso Kagaku Corp 画像形成システムおよび画像形成装置

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5456539A (en) * 1993-05-25 1995-10-10 Duplex Printer, Inc. Printer with dual opposing printheads
US5688057A (en) * 1993-05-25 1997-11-18 Twigs, Inc. Method of printing using dual opposing printheads
JP2005047267A (ja) * 2003-07-14 2005-02-24 Riso Kagaku Corp 画像形成システムおよび画像形成装置

Similar Documents

Publication Publication Date Title
JPH0263763A (ja) 出力方法及びその装置
EP0621538B1 (en) Output method and apparatus
JP3029136B2 (ja) 出力方法及び装置
JPH0441548B2 (ja)
JPH04189167A (ja) オーバレイ展開制御方式
JPH07112552A (ja) 印刷装置における帳票印刷制御方法及び装置
JP2001002279A (ja) 画像出力装置及びその制御方法
JP3177034B2 (ja) 出力情報処理方法および出力情報処理装置
JPH0659833A (ja) ネットワーク環境のプリンタ
JPH0361562A (ja) プリンタ装置
JP3143118B2 (ja) プリンタ及び印字イメージパターン展開方法
JPH09254485A (ja) 画像形成装置
JPH0624105A (ja) 画像形成装置
KR100311027B1 (ko) 멀티페이지 인쇄방법
JP2989727B2 (ja) 印刷装置および印刷方法
JPS6246010B2 (ja)
JPH111048A (ja) 印刷制御方法および印刷装置
JPH07195760A (ja) プリンタ制御装置
JPH0746344A (ja) 印刷装置
JPH0564938A (ja) プリンタ
JPH05278275A (ja) 出力方法及びその装置
JPH061020A (ja) 記録装置
JPH0592636A (ja) 印刷制御装置
JPH04339675A (ja) ラベルプリンタ
JPH11305963A (ja) 印刷装置及びその制御方法